List of storms named Percy

List of storms with the same or similar names From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

The name Percy has been used to name six tropical cyclones worldwide: five in the Western North Pacific Ocean and one in the South Pacific.

In the Western Pacific:

  • Typhoon Percy (1980) (T8014, 19W) – A strong Category 4 typhoon that brushed southern Taiwan before weakening and striking southeastern mainland China
  • Typhoon Percy (1983) (T8320, 21W, Yayang) – Category 1 typhoon that only had minor effects, primarily in the Philippines
  • Tropical Storm Percy (1987) (T8702, 02W) – A weak and short-lived storm that never affected land
  • Typhoon Percy (1990) (T9006, 07W) – Category 4 typhoon that crossed extreme northern Luzon as a Category 2 before hitting southeastern China as a weak Category 1 typhoon
  • Typhoon Percy (1993) (T9306, 12W) – Weak typhoon that hit southwestern Japan

In the Southern Pacific:

  • Cyclone Percy (2005) – powerful Category 5 cyclone that caused severe damage in the Cook Islands
